## Escalation — Stringharvest extraction script

If Stringharvest fails during the nightly run, retry once manually. Persistent failures usually mean a malformed locale file landed in the Bramble repo. Revert the offending commit and rerun. If extraction completes but strings are missing downstream, escalate to the localization tooling owners via their team address.

escalation mailbox, bafog-fafog: ulador@paliqlabs.internal

## Further Reading

New to Quillpress, our PDF invoice renderer? Start with the template DSL guide, then skim the font-embedding gotchas doc (trust us, you'll need it). The rendering pipeline diagram is also worth ten minutes of your time. All of that, plus architecture notes, lives on our internal wiki page:

operations page: https://confluence.qorvelsys.internal/browse/projects/projects/f004fd0d

## Read-Replica Lag Alarm

New folks: the ReplicaLagHigh alarm covers the Ostrel reporting replicas. It fires when lag exceeds 90 seconds for five minutes. Most triggers come from the nightly Bramwell export job, which is expected and auto-resolves. Do not fail over the replica yourself — that requires the data-platform lead's approval and a change ticket. If the alarm persists past 20 minutes with no export running, write to the platform inbox.

billing contact of yahip-yadup = eliax.druix@zemvarworks.corp